WebbThe putative stem cells of the bronchus are basal cells, which are believed to give rise to the differentiation of ciliated, mucous and neuroendocrine cells. Lung cancer may arise from all these differentiated and undifferentiated cells , from either the central (small cell lung cancer and squamous cell carcinoma) or the peripheral (adenocarcinoma) airway … WebbSmall cell lung cancers include ICD-O morphology codes M-80413, M-80423, M-80433, M-80443, and M-80453. WebbMost lung cancers are classified as non- small cell lung cancer (NSCLC). About half of these are squamous cell carcinomas (SCC). SCC, sometimes called epidermoid carcinoma, is more prevalent in men and arises in the lining of the large air passageways, or bronchi. Another common type of NSCLC is adenocarcinoma, which occurs at the outer edges ...
